Students who will appear for the CBSE 11th exam can check out the following unit-wise syllabus for the Business Studies subject. The board divided the syllabus into two parts. Part A of the business studies is for 40 marks and covers the foundation of business, while Part B deals with finance and trade and is for 40 marks. The CBSE board provides Part A of the 11th Class Business Studies syllabus under the following six units. Check out the detailed syllabus in the sections below.
History of Trade and Commerce in India: Indigenous Banking System, Rise of Intermediaries, Transport, Trading Communities: Merchant Corporations, Major Trade Centres, Major Imports and Exports, Position of Indian Sub-Continent in the World Economy
Business – meaning and characteristics
Business, profession and employment – Concept
Objectives of business
Classification of business activities - Industry and Commerce
Industry types: primary, secondary, tertiary. Meaning and subgroups
Commerce-trade: (types-internal, external; wholesale and retail) and auxiliaries to trade; (banking, insurance, transportation, warehousing, communication, and advertising) – meaning
Business risk - Concept
Sole Proprietorship - Concept, merits and limitations
Partnership - Concept, types, merits and limitations of partnership, registration of a partnership firm, partnership deed. Types of partners
Hindu Undivided Family Business: Concept
Cooperative Societies-Concept, merits, and limitations.
Company - Concept, merits and limitations; Types: Private, Public and One Person Company – Concept
Formation of a company - stages, important documents to be used in the formation of a company
Choice of form of business organisation
Public sector and private sector enterprises – Concept
Forms of public sector enterprises: Departmental Undertakings, Statutory Corporations and Government Company
Global Enterprises – Feature Joint venture Public private partnership – concept
Business services – meaning and types. Banking: Types of bank accounts - savings, current, recurring, fixed deposit and multiple option deposit account
Banking services with particular reference to Bank Draft, Bank Overdraft, and Cash Credit. E-Banking: meaning, types of digital payments
Insurance – Principles. Types – life, health, fire and marine insurance – concept
Postal Service - Mail, Registered Post, Parcel, Speed Post, Courier - meaning
E - business: Concept, scope and benefits
Concept of social responsibility
Case of social responsibility
Responsibility towards owners, investors, consumers, employees, government and community
Role of business in environmental protection
Business Ethics - Concept and Elements
The board provides Part B of the CBSE 11th Class Business Studies syllabus under the following four units. Check out the detailed syllabus in the sections below.
Concept of business finance
Owners’ funds - equity shares, preference shares, and retained earnings
Borrowed funds: debentures and bonds, loans from financial institutions and commercial banks, public deposits, trade credit, Inter Corporate Deposits (ICD)
Entrepreneurship Development (ED): Concept, Characteristics and Need. Process of Entrepreneurship Development: Start-up India Scheme, ways to fund start-ups. Intellectual Property Rights and Entrepreneurship
Small-scale enterprise as defined by the MSMED Act 2006 (Micro, Small and Medium Enterprise Development Act)
Role of small business in India with special reference to rural areas
Government schemes and agencies for small-scale industries: National Small Industries Corporation (NSIC) and District Industrial Centre (DIC) with special reference to rural, backwards areas
Internal trade - meaning and types of services rendered by a wholesaler and a retailer
Types of retail trade: Itinerant and small-scale fixed shop retailers
Large-scale retailers, departmental stores, chain stores – concept
GST (Goods and Services Tax): Concept and key features
International trade: concept and benefits
Export trade – Meaning and procedure
Import Trade - Meaning and Procedure
Documents involved in International Trade: indent, letter of credit, shipping order, shipping bills, mate’s receipt (DA/DP)
World Trade Organisation (WTO): meaning and objectives
Students can refer to the table below to learn more about the marks distribution for the CBSE 11th Class 2025-26 Business Studies.
Units | Marks | |
Part A | Foundations of Business | |
1 | Nature and Purpose of Business | 16 |
2 | Forms of Business Organisations | |
3 | Public, Private and Global Enterprises | 14 |
4 | Business Services | |
5 | Emerging Modes of Business | 10 |
6 | Social Responsibility of Business and Business Ethics | |
Total | 40 | |
Part B | Finance and Trade | |
7 | Sources of Business Finance | 20 |
8 | Small Business | |
9 | Internal Trade | 20 |
10 | International Business | |
Total | 40 | |
Project Work (One) | 20 | |
Grand Total | 100 |

Taking a drop year to reappear for the Karnataka Common Entrance Test (KCET) is a well-defined process. As a repeater, you are fully eligible to take the exam again to improve your score and secure a better rank for admissions.
The main procedure involves submitting a new application for the KCET through the official Karnataka Examinations Authority (KEA) website when registrations open for the next academic session. You must pay the required application fee and complete all formalities just like any other candidate. A significant advantage for you is that you do not need to retake your 12th board exams. Your previously secured board marks in the qualifying subjects will be used again. Your new KCET rank will be calculated by combining these existing board marks with your new score from the KCET exam. Therefore, your entire focus during this year should be on preparing thoroughly for the KCET to achieve a higher score.

Yes, you can switch from Science in Karnataka State Board to Commerce in CBSE for 12th. You will need a Transfer Certificate from your current school and meet the CBSE school’s admission requirements. Since you haven’t studied Commerce subjects like Accountancy, Economics, and Business Studies, you may need to catch up before or during 12th. Not all CBSE schools accept direct admission to 12th from another board, so some may ask you to join Class 11 first. Make sure to check the school’s rules and plan your subject preparation.
